İçindekiler:

Neden tepki daha hızlı?
Neden tepki daha hızlı?

Video: Neden tepki daha hızlı?

Video: Neden tepki daha hızlı?
Video: Monitörlerde Yenileme Hızı ve Tepki Süresi Nedir? 2024, Kasım
Anonim

ReactJS, DOM'nin güncellenmesini önlemeye yardımcı olduğundan, uygulamaların Daha hızlı ve daha iyi UX sunun. ReactJS, web sitesi sunucusundan oluşturulan toplam sayfaların iyileştirilmesine yardımcı olmak için tasarlanmıştır. Ayrıca, istemci tarafında işlemek için düğümleri kullanır.

Aynı şekilde, sanal Dom neden daha hızlı tepki veriyor?

Tepki NS hızlı çünkü sadece manipüle ediyor DOM gerektiği kadar. Değişiklikleri güncellemek çok Daha hızlı tamamını yeniden inşa etmektense DOM ağaç sıfırdan. Tuttuğu için bunu yapabilir sanal DOM bileşenimizi bellekte en son güncellediğimiz veya oluşturduğumuz zamandan temsil.

Aynı şekilde, tepki neden daha iyi? İşte birkaç neden neden tepki çok hızlı bir şekilde popüler hale geldi: DOM API ile çalışmak zor. Tepki temel olarak geliştiricilere gerçek tarayıcıdan daha kolay olan sanal bir tarayıcıyla çalışma yeteneği verir. React'in sanal tarayıcı, geliştirici ile gerçek tarayıcı arasında bir aracı görevi görür.

Ayrıca, tepki neden açısaldan daha hızlı?

Uygulama boyutu ve performansı – Açısal küçük bir avantajı var Sanal DOM nedeniyle, ReactJS uygulamaları AngularJS'den daha hızlı Aynı boyuttaki uygulamalar. Ayrıca, Açısal kıyasla daha küçük bir uygulama boyutuna sahip Tepki Redux ile aynı araştırmada: Aktarım boyutu 129 KB, Tepki + Redux 193 KB'dir.

Tepki uygulamamı nasıl daha hızlı hale getirebilirim?

React Uygulamaları için 21 Performans Optimizasyon Tekniği

  1. Değişmez Veri Yapılarını Kullanma.
  2. İşlev/Durumsuz Bileşenler ve React.
  3. Çoklu Chunk Dosyaları.
  4. React'i kullanın.
  5. İşleme İşlevinde Satır İçi İşlev Tanımından kaçının.
  6. JavaScript'te Olay Eylemini Kısıtlama ve Geri Dönme.
  7. Harita için Anahtar olarak Dizin kullanmaktan kaçının.
  8. İlk Durumlarda Proplardan Kaçınmak.

Önerilen: